Dry ice has a sublimation temperature of -78.5°C and rapidly turns into gas at room temperature. For many businesses involved in dry ice cleaning, food cold chains, biotechnology, and healthcare, watching purchased dry ice gradually evaporate represents a substantial hidden cost. Ordinary plastic insulated containers and coolers cannot withstand such extremely low temperatures. They are prone to embrittlement and cracking and cannot effectively prevent heat transfer.

Unlike ordinary household or lightweight coolers on the market, FOSECO dry ice storage containers are purpose-built assets designed for ultra-low-temperature environments rated to -80°C. They provide three core advantages:
High-specification, high-density PU (polyurethane) foam technology seals cold air inside the container, significantly extending dry ice storage time and solid-state life.
The container is rotationally molded in one piece from food-grade PE (polyethylene). Its seamless construction is impact-resistant, low-temperature-resistant, and resistant to embrittlement, allowing it to withstand forklift handling and high-impact logistics operations.
Designed around the carbon dioxide released by dry ice, the container maintains a highly airtight seal to block external warm air while safely releasing small amounts of pressure to prevent deformation.

A: Dry ice continues to sublimate depending on the ambient temperature and how frequently the container is opened. When using a FOSECO industrial dry ice storage container, reducing the frequency of opening and filling unused space with dry newspaper or blankets can keep the daily natural sublimation rate within an extremely low range. Depending on the environment and operating conditions, the rate is typically approximately 4%–8% per 24 hours, delivering significantly better storage performance than an ordinary insulated container.

A: When dry ice sublimates, its volume expands approximately 800 times. If an insulated container were completely sealed with no pressure-relief space, excessive internal pressure could cause the container to expand or even rupture. FOSECO containers use highly elastic airtight gaskets to prevent external warm air from entering while allowing small amounts of pressure to be safely released when internal pressure becomes too high, ensuring safe industrial operation.
